C语言基础——函数的课堂笔记

大家好,我是华子,这是我的随堂笔记,有一些零碎的知识,身为大一新生的我,我并不会太多的代码,每个代码其实都是我的作业和课堂练习,我很喜欢这个社区,有很多东西可以学习,之前我也是在抄袭别人的代码,然后慢慢自己开始研究怎么改变,哪怕是一个数值,也算是我小小的进步。所以也希望在看我文章的你能够打开笔记本多思考多写代码。

//strcat(字符数组1,字符数组2);strwlr(字符串)大写换成小写,strupr小写换大写。
//有三个字符串,要求找出其中最大者

#include<stdio.h>
#include<string.h>
void main()
{
    char string [20];
    char str [3][20];
    int i;
    for(i=0;i<3;i++)
        gets(str[i]);
    if(strcmp(str[0]//书上P164

    int i;
    long s1=1,s2=1,s3=1,s;

//为什么要使用函数,减少重复代码,清晰,可读性好,缩短程序周期,提高程序设计和调试效率
  
    //自定义函数;函数名,函数首,函数体,void表示空,可以省略
    //例如:
    int max(int x,int,y)//类型
    {int z;
    z=(x>y)?x:y;
    return (z);//return返回值函数的结果,把值返回到调用的位置
    }
    //形参:定义时的变量名,实参:执行时的参数。个数类型全部一致
    //单向传递,实参和形参分别占用不同的存储单元,传值调用
    //printf有啥写啥
    //main函数写在后面不需要原型声明,在自定义函数上方需要原型声明,可以省略名,不可以省略类型
    //声明介绍函数
#include <stdio.h> //统计出若干个学生的平均成绩和低于平均分的人数。
int main()
{
    int x,y,i,j;//x为平均成绩,i为学生的人数,j为低于平均分的人数 
    int a[10];
    scanf("%d,%d",&x,&y);
    for(i=1;i<=10;i++)
    y=i+a[i+1];
    x=y/10;
    pringtf("平均成绩为%d",x);
        if(a[i]<x)
    {
        j=0;
        j=j+1;
    }
        else
        j=j;
    return 0;
}*/
 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值